The Challenge of Multi-Site Fuel Management
Managing fuel across multiple locations is complex. Without real-time tracking, secure dispensing, and automated reporting, businesses face fuel losses, inefficiencies, and compliance risks — all of which impact operational costs.
1. Lack of Real-Time Fuel Visibility
Without live monitoring, companies risk unplanned shortages, over-purchasing, and delayed reporting. A fuel level tracking system eliminates guesswork and ensures optimal fuel allocation.
2. Inconsistent Fuel Dispensing & Record-Keeping
Manual multi-site tracking leads to discrepancies, lost transactions, and increased admin work. Automated fuel management systems ensure every litre dispensed is accurately measured and recorded.
3. Fuel Theft & Unauthorized Access
Without strict access controls, fuel is vulnerable to theft and misuse. A secure dispensing system ensures only authorized vehicles and personnel can access fuel, reducing losses.
4. Compliance & Regulatory Challenges
Manual reporting leads to data errors, lost rebate opportunities, and audit risks. A bulk fuel management system automates compliance, making audits seamless.
5. Operational Downtime Due to Poor Coordination
Fuel shortages halt operations. A real-time monitoring system prevents downtime by optimizing fuel deliveries and usage.
An integrated bulk fuel management system is the key to reducing losses, improving efficiency, and ensuring compliance across multiple sites.
